1. Classic Black Blazer with Tailored Pants

A classic black blazer paired with tailored pants is a timeless interview outfit that instantly communicates professionalism and confidence. The structured silhouette enhances your posture while creating a clean and sharp look. This outfit works across multiple industries, making it a safe yet powerful choice for first impressions.
To elevate the look, pair it with a crisp white blouse and subtle accessories. Neutral tones help keep the focus on your personality and communication skills. Opt for well-fitted pieces to avoid looking too stiff or too casual, ensuring you strike the perfect balance between modern and professional style.

3. White Button-Down Shirt with Pencil Skirt

A white button-down shirt combined with a pencil skirt creates a sharp and confident appearance. This combination is especially suitable for corporate roles where a formal dress code is expected. The clean lines and structured fit enhance your overall presentation.
Ensure the shirt is well-pressed and fits perfectly to avoid looking sloppy. Pair with closed-toe heels and keep makeup subtle. This outfit highlights discipline and attention to detail, qualities employers always appreciate during interviews.

6. Blazer with Dark Wash Jeans

For a business casual interview, pairing a blazer with dark wash jeans is a smart choice. It combines professionalism with a relaxed touch, making it ideal for startups or creative roles.
Ensure the jeans are clean, fitted, and free from distressing. Pair with a structured blazer and polished shoes to keep the outfit interview-appropriate. This look shows you understand modern workplace fashion while still respecting professionalism.
